Output 76fa2bd291b3e1e1f3074c666371f4c42033ebe3021691dc961c4b2f28043974:7

value
74973979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43849383122ebb8a28268a89700c9f723663b5b8 OP_EQUALVERIFY OP_CHECKSIG
address
17A16QmavnUfCW11DAApiJxp7ARnxN5pGX
transaction
76fa2bd291b3e1e1f3074c666371f4c42033ebe3021691dc961c4b2f28043974
spent
true